Supreme Court Says Some Drug Users Can Possess Guns

The US Supreme Court ruled that the government can’t categorically bar marijuana users from possessing firearms in a decision that expands the Constitution’s Second Amendment. Mike McKee reports on "Bloomberg Open Interest." (Source: Blo…
